Random Variables and Probability Distributions
摘要
This chapter focuses on both discrete and continuous random variables and their corresponding probability distributions. Discrete random variables are introduced through the binomial, hypergeometric, and Poisson distributions, while continuous random variables are illustrated with the uniform, normal, chi-square, t, and F distributions. The chapter emphasizes the mathematical foundations of these distributions, including their expected values and variances. Practical applications are discussed, along with techniques for calculating probabilities using software tools like R, Excel, and Stata.
